Output bb2d623a242936f93467655d52ae0be8d4e4974423150853bf2cecd91ae26fef:36

value
12937133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6374c6ba026773ef858173d3ec26ba12b25e42f6 OP_EQUAL
address
MGy32BMNBhB5sKxHk9stPBvya3WsoxDJTm
transaction
bb2d623a242936f93467655d52ae0be8d4e4974423150853bf2cecd91ae26fef
spent
true